
Linda Drew joins our Board at just the right time, as we are growing in membership and monthly attendance at events, so her energy and wise counsel will be invaluable. Right out of the gate she will take on the important role of Events Registration Coordinator. Linda writes:
I was born in Los Angeles and grew up in Saratoga, where I graduated from Saratoga High School. I entered UC Berkeley, graduating in 1977 with a degree in Human Biodynamics.
I married Chuck Drew the next year, and we settled in San Carlos, and had two children, Chris and Allie.
Later on, I pursued a career teaching sales and public speaking for the Dale Carnegie Courses, as well as serving as a recruiter in the high-tech industry. And I enjoyed volunteering for good causes: as president of our children’s PTA’s Coordinating Council; San Carlos Little League; and PAMF Community Advisory Council. My longest involvement was with Peninsula Volunteers, Inc., where, for 27 years, I served on its board and chaired many of its fundraising efforts.
Chuck and I moved to Santa Rosa in 2019, where I am currently on the steering committee of Women’s Health at Memorial Hospital. Plus, I joined IMPACT 100 in 2021, and was president in 2025.
Chuck and I have two grandchildren: one in Santa Rosa and one a little farther away—in Chengdu, China! In my spare time, I enjoy traveling, hiking, listening to audiobooks, gardening, salt cellar collecting, visiting museums, and playing board games with friends.
It’s a full life, indeed!
